Earthwork Service in Atlanta, GA
Earthwork services encompass a range of excavation and grading projects essential for preparing land for construction, landscaping, or drainage improvements. These services typically involve clearing, leveling, and shaping the soil to create a stable foundation for driveways, patios, building pads, or landscaping features. Property owners often seek earthwork to ensure proper drainage, prevent erosion, or to establish a level surface for future construction or landscaping projects.
Before requesting earthwork services, property owners should consider the scope of their project, including the size of the area, soil conditions, and any existing structures or utilities that may impact the work. Understanding the desired outcome, such as a flat yard or properly sloped drainage area, can help facilitate effective planning. It is also helpful to clarify any permits or regulations that might apply to excavation or grading work in the local area.

Common Earthwork Service Jobs
Site Preparation - clearing and leveling land to prepare for construction or landscaping projects.
Excavation Services - removing soil or debris to create foundations, trenches, or drainage solutions.
Grading and Sloping - shaping the land to improve drainage and prevent erosion around the property.
Drainage Solutions - installing systems to direct water away from structures and prevent flooding.
Foundation Backfill - filling around new foundations to ensure stability and support.
Land Clearing - removing trees, shrubs, and debris to open up space for development or landscaping.
Earthwork Service Questions
What types of projects require earthwork services? Earthwork services are commonly used for grading, excavation, foundation preparation, and site leveling for residential and commercial properties.
How does earthwork improve property drainage? Proper earthwork ensures the ground slopes away from structures, reducing water pooling and directing runoff effectively.
What equipment is typically used in earthwork projects? Heavy machinery like excavators, bulldozers, and graders are standard tools for earthmoving and site preparation.
Why is site clearing an important part of earthwork? Site clearing removes trees, debris, and old structures to create a safe, level area for construction or landscaping.
